Transaction 581896afc6c4638f252f0ae6a20511c40fe59491dc42d6168359e7527037ab90
1 Input
1 Output
-
581896afc6c4638f252f0ae6a20511c40fe59491dc42d6168359e7527037ab90:0
- value
- 1664027
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cef9ba1735092945d0a08f02f1041f576ed2f41
- address
- bc1q9nhehgtn2zffghg2prcz7yzp74mw6t6p73klhw